Cape Coral, Florida, is a paradise for those who appreciate a unique blend of nature and modern conveniences. This Gulf Coast city is renowned for its waterfront wonder, having more canals than any other city globally. Offering diverse rental options including condos, single-family homes and studio apartments, Cape Coral caters to an extensive range of renters.
Florida law supports renters with clear protections against unreasonable lease terms and unwarranted eviction. The sunny city also hosts a myriad of attractions for its residents. From boating and fishing in the Caloosahatchee River to exploring the Tom Allen Memorial Butterfly Garden, the recreational opportunities are bountiful.
Studio apartments are a popular rental choice in Cape Coral. These units are particularly appealing to young professionals, retirees and anyone seeking a minimalist lifestyle. The convenience of maintenance-free living in a compact, yet stylish space, draws renters towards studio apartments.
Typical amenities in Cape Coral's studio apartments include modern appliances, on-site laundry and often access to swimming pools and fitness centers. The city's studio apartment communities often lure renters with their communal gatherings and proximity to local hotspots.
Renters can find numerous studio apartments in neighborhoods like Pelican and Caloosahatchee. With their access to sandy beaches, parks and marinas, these neighborhoods provide an enticing coastal living experience. A vibrant food scene, chic boutiques and entertainment options further enhance the appeal of these communities.
